/**
|
|
* Parses meta data from audio files using the Jaudiotagger library
|
|
* (http://www.jthink.net/jaudiotagger/)
|
|
*
|
|
* @author Sindre Mehus
|
|
*/
|
|
public class JaudiotaggerParser extends MetaDataParser {
|
|
|
|
private static final Logger LOG = LoggerFactory.getLogger(JaudiotaggerParser.class);
|
|
private static final Pattern GENRE_PATTERN = Pattern.compile("\\((\\d+)\\).*");
|
|
private static final Pattern TRACK_NUMBER_PATTERN = Pattern.compile("(\\d+)/\\d+");
|
|
private static final Pattern YEAR_NUMBER_PATTERN = Pattern.compile("(\\d{4}).*");
|
|
|
|
static {
|
|
try {
|
|
LogManager.getLogManager().reset();
|
|
} catch (Throwable x) {
|
|
LOG.warn("Failed to turn off logging from Jaudiotagger.", x);
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Parses meta data for the given music file. No guessing or reformatting is done.
|
|
*
|
|
*
|
|
* @param file The music file to parse.
|
|
* @return Meta data for the file.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Override
|
|
public MetaData getRawMetaData(File file) {
|
|
|
|
MetaData metaData = new MetaData();
|
|
|
|
try {
|
|
AudioFile audioFile = AudioFileIO.read(file);
|
|
Tag tag = audioFile.getTag();
|
|
if (tag != null) {
|
|
metaData.setAlbumName(getTagField(tag, FieldKey.ALBUM));
|
|
metaData.setTitle(getTagField(tag, FieldKey.TITLE));
|
|
metaData.setYear(parseYear(getTagField(tag, FieldKey.YEAR)));
|
|
metaData.setGenre(mapGenre(getTagField(tag, FieldKey.GENRE)));
|
|
metaData.setDiscNumber(parseInteger(getTagField(tag, FieldKey.DISC_NO)));
|
|
metaData.setTrackNumber(parseTrackNumber(getTagField(tag, FieldKey.TRACK)));
|
|
|
|
String songArtist = getTagField(tag, FieldKey.ARTIST);
|
|
String albumArtist = getTagField(tag, FieldKey.ALBUM_ARTIST);
|
|
metaData.setArtist(StringUtils.isBlank(songArtist) ? albumArtist : songArtist);
|
|
metaData.setAlbumArtist(StringUtils.isBlank(albumArtist) ? songArtist : albumArtist);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
AudioHeader audioHeader = audioFile.getAudioHeader();
|
|
if (audioHeader != null) {
|
|
metaData.setVariableBitRate(audioHeader.isVariableBitRate());
|
|
metaData.setBitRate((int) audioHeader.getBitRateAsNumber());
|
|
metaData.setDurationSeconds(audioHeader.getTrackLength());
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
|
|
} catch (Throwable x) {
|
|
LOG.warn("Error when parsing tags in " + file, x);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return metaData;
|
|
}

/**
|
|
* Sometimes the genre is returned as "(17)" or "(17)Rock", instead of "Rock". This method
|
|
* maps the genre ID to the corresponding text.
|
|
*/
|
|
private String mapGenre(String genre) {
|
|
if (genre == null) {
|
|
return null;
|
|
}
|
|
Matcher matcher = GENRE_PATTERN.matcher(genre);
|
|
if (matcher.matches()) {
|
|
int genreId = Integer.parseInt(matcher.group(1));
|
|
if (genreId >= 0 && genreId < GenreTypes.getInstanceOf().getSize()) {
|
|
return GenreTypes.getInstanceOf().getValueForId(genreId);
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
return genre;
|
|
}

/**
|
|
* Updates the given file with the given meta data.
|
|
*
|
|
* @param file The music file to update.
|
|
* @param metaData The new meta data.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Override
|
|
public void setMetaData(MediaFile file, MetaData metaData) {
|
|
|
|
try {
|
|
AudioFile audioFile = AudioFileIO.read(file.getFile());
|
|
Tag tag = audioFile.getTagOrCreateAndSetDefault();
|
|
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.ARTIST, StringUtils.trimToEmpty(metaData.getArtist()));
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.ALBUM, StringUtils.trimToEmpty(metaData.getAlbumName()));
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.TITLE, StringUtils.trimToEmpty(metaData.getTitle()));
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.GENRE, StringUtils.trimToEmpty(metaData.getGenre()));
|
|
try {
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.ALBUM_ARTIST, StringUtils.trimToEmpty(metaData.getAlbumArtist()));
|
|
} catch (Exception x) {
|
|
// Silently ignored. ID3v1 doesn't support album artist.
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
Integer track = metaData.getTrackNumber();
|
|
if (track == null) {
|
|
tag.deleteField(FieldKey.TRACK);
|
|
} else {
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.TRACK, String.valueOf(track));
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
Integer year = metaData.getYear();
|
|
if (year == null) {
|
|
tag.deleteField(FieldKey.YEAR);
|
|
} else {
|
|
tag.setField(FieldKey.YEAR, String.valueOf(year));
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
audioFile.commit();
|
|
|
|
} catch (Throwable x) {
|
|
LOG.warn("Failed to update tags for file " + file, x);
|
|
throw new RuntimeException("Failed to update tags for file " + file + ". " + x.getMessage(), x);
|
|
}
|
|
}
